This is my second layout using Swirlydoos March kit, "Vintage Chic". I've also used some stamps by Vilda Stamps on this layout.
Here are some details on it.
I've used a chicken wire mascil by Clear Scraps and some mist to create the hint of green on the background.
I've stamped the images using acrylic paint.
